Unique Skill of Axel Toupane
Axel Toupane's greatest strength is his defensive versatility.
Standing at 6'7 with a 7'0 wingspan, he can guard multiple positions, from quick guards to physical forwards.
His lateral quickness and high basketball IQ allow him to disrupt passing lanes and contest shots effectively, making him a valuable role player in any system.
